    GameStop stock tanks on move to issue shares, quarterly sales decline

    GameStop shares tanked on Friday morning after the company filed to sell stock and pre-announced sales for the first quarter that came in below Wall Street's estimates.

    Dow hits record-high, gas prices to rise: Catalysts

    On today's episode of Catalysts, co-hosts Seana Smith and Madison Mills discuss the state of the consumer and stock market gains following Wednesday's Consumer Price Index (CPI) print. The Dow Jones Industrial Average (^DJI) surpassed the 40,000 mark for the first time, while the S&P 500 (^GSPC) topped the 5,300 level amid broad-based market gains. Despite the rally, UBS Investment Bank Chief Strategist Bhanu Baweja joins the show to discuss why he believes markets may be due for "a reality check." Compounding the financial strain on consumers, the Energy Information Administration (EIA) reports that gas prices could increase by $0.10 this summer, prompting an examination of the state of the consumer. The show covers several trending tickers, including Deere & Company (DE), which lowered its full-year profit guidance, GameStop (GME), which experienced a slump amid the slowing meme trade frenzy, and Canada Goose (GOOS), which beat fourth-quarter profit expectations.     Is this week's meme stock saga already over?

    Meme stocks like GameStop (GME), AMC Entertainment (AMC), BlackBerry (BB), and Tupperware (TUP) are falling back down after a rally spurred by X (formerly Twitter) user "Roaring Kitty's" return to social media earlier this week. Yahoo Finance's Jared Blikre breaks down key meme stocks and analyzes how 2024's rally compares to the 2021 meme trade frenzy.
